📝 Match Preview
A classic La Liga clash with a stark contrast in fortunes pits relegation-threatened Levante against the relentless top-three machine of Atletico Madrid. The visitors arrive as heavy favourites, and the data suggests they have every right to be. Levante's season has been a struggle, sitting 19th with just 17 points from 20 games. Their recent form shows flickers of life, most notably a stunning 3-0 away victory at Sevilla and a thrilling 3-2 home win over Elche just last week. However, these positives are sandwiched between concerning results: a 2-0 defeat at Real Madrid and a 1-1 draw with Espanyol. Their underlying numbers are weak, averaging just 0.90 goals scored and conceding 1.20 per game over their last ten. At home, they've been slightly more potent (1.25 goals scored) but also more vulnerable (1.50 conceded), managing only one win in their last four at their own ground. Atletico Madrid, in contrast, are cruising. Third in the table with 44 points, their recent record of seven wins, two draws, and just one loss from ten games is the mark of a serious contender. That sole defeat came against giants Real Madrid in the Super Cup. Their league form is imperious, with recent victories including a 3-0 demolition of Mallorca, a 1-0 win over Alaves, and a commanding 3-0 away win at Girona. Crucially, they are a formidable away side, unbeaten in their last five on the road (three wins, two draws), scoring 1.80 goals per game while conceding a miserly 0.80. The head-to-head history makes for grim reading if you're a Levante fan. In the last nine meetings, Atletico have won four and drawn three. Most damningly, Levante have **never beaten Atletico Madrid at home** in the data provided, recording zero wins, three draws, and two losses. The most recent encounter in November 2025 ended in a comprehensive 3-1 victory for Atletico. Statistically, the gulf is clear. Atletico averages more shots (15.11 vs 11.11), more shots on target (5.44 vs 3.00), enjoys greater possession (53.8% vs 45.3%), and completes passes with far more accuracy (86.4% vs 79.2%).
